Koti kehitys Mikä on luokan muuttuja? - määritelmä techopediasta

Mikä on luokan muuttuja? - määritelmä techopediasta

Sisällysluettelo:

Anonim

Määritelmä - mitä luokkamuuttuja tarkoittaa?

Luokkamuuttuja on tärkeä osa olio-ohjelmointia (OOP), joka määrittelee tietyn luokan ominaisuuden tai ominaisuuden ja jota voidaan kutsua jäsenmuuttujaksi tai staattiseksi jäsenmuuttujaksi.

Techopedia selittää luokan muuttujan

Monet olio-ohjelmointikielet (OOP) käyttävät luokkaa mallina tietyntyyppiselle objektille. Jokainen tämän luokan yksittäinen manifestaatio tunnetaan esiintymänä. Eri saman luokan esiintymillä on yhteiset ominaisuudet ja rakenteen näkökohdat. Monia luokkien ominaisuuksia kutsutaan tietokentiksi. Kehittäjät käyttävät myös menetelmiä vaikuttaakseen luokan ja sen esiintymien käyttäytymiseen. Esimerkkejä luokkia käyttävistä ohjelmointikieleistä ovat Java, C. C #, C ++, Microsoft Visual Basic (VB) ja PHP.


Koska luokamuuttujat koskevat koko luokkaa ja kaikkia sen ilmentymiä - vaikka tietyllä esiintymällä voi olla myös omia muuttujia - luokkamuuttujien ja yksittäiseen ilmentymään rajoitettujen muuttujien vuorovaikutuksessa voi olla hämmennystä. Ohjelmoinnissa yleisiin kysymyksiin kuuluu, milloin luokkamuuttujat ja ilmentymimuuttujat määritetään, ja onko näillä kahdella erityyppisellä muuttujalla mahdollista päällekkäisyyttä tai vaikuttaako toisiinsa odottamattomasti. Vaikka jotkut koodit toimivat ilman luokkamuuttujien erityistä määritelmää, ammattilaiset pitävät luokkamuuttujien lisäämistä usein tarkempana koodauksena.

Mikä on luokan muuttuja? - määritelmä techopediasta